The cyber essentials plus scheme is an extension of the original Cyber Essentials certification, which was launched by the UK government in 2014. While the basic Cyber Essentials certification focuses on implementing essential security controls to help protect against the most common cyber threats, Cyber Essentials Plus takes it a step further by requiring organizations to undergo a more thorough assessment of their cybersecurity measures.

To achieve Cyber Essentials Plus certification, organizations are required to undergo a comprehensive security assessment conducted by an independent cybersecurity firm. During the assessment, the firm will evaluate the organization’s adherence to the five key security controls outlined in the Cyber Essentials framework, which include secure configuration, boundary firewalls, access control, patch management, and malware protection.

Furthermore, becoming Cyber Essentials Plus certified can also help organizations comply with regulatory requirements and industry standards. In today’s increasingly regulated business environment, cybersecurity has become a key focus for regulators, with many industries requiring organizations to demonstrate that they have appropriate security measures in place to protect sensitive data.

By obtaining Cyber Essentials Plus certification, organizations can showcase their commitment to cybersecurity and demonstrate compliance with industry regulations, giving them a competitive edge in the marketplace. Additionally, certification can also help organizations win new business and secure contracts with government agencies, as many government contracts now require suppliers to hold Cyber Essentials certification.
